Chelmsford to Lochgelly by train

A train trip from Chelmsford to Lochgelly takes about 8hrs 35 mins on average, covering roughly 340 miles (548 kilometres). With around 16 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£42.60,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Chelmsford to Lochgelly start from as little as £42.60

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Chelmsford to Lochgelly start from £97.50 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Chelmsford to Lochgelly are available for £125.40 one way

Facilities and Amenities

Chelmsford train station offers a myriad of facilities to meet the diverse needs of its passengers. With a ticket office open from 5:50 AM to 10 PM on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 7 AM to 11 PM on Sundays, you have plenty of opportunity to grab or collect your tickets. For added convenience, ticket machines are available around the clock. Chelmsford station has taken steps to ensure accessibility for all, offering step-free access, accessible ticket machines, and toilets. CCTV coverage ensures safety, while its commitment to passenger comfort is evident in its waiting rooms, open from 5 AM to 11 PM throughout the week.

When it comes to shopping and dining, you're never short of options at Chelmsford. Grab a coffee from Coffee Link, savor a sushi roll at Ume Garden’s Sushi & Bento, or refresh yourself with a snack from one of the vending machines. If you’re in the mood for something familiar, Costa Coffee and Puccino's Deli are ready to serve you. There is even an ATM available to handle any last-minute cash needs!

Getting Around

Transport links at Chelmsford are carefully designed to ensure seamless travel. When railway services are disrupted, rail replacement buses conveniently pick up and drop off at the bus stops on Victoria Road at the station entrance. The local bus service network is quite efficient, covering Chelmsford and nearby towns and can be further explored at FirstGroup. Plus, a PLUSBUS extension to your train ticket guarantees unlimited bus travel in town at discounted rates.

Taxis are readily available from the rank just outside the station for those preferring private conveyance while the cycling community may take advantage of the extensive bicycle storage facilities with 960 spaces and sheltered, CCTV-monitored secure options available.

Facilities and Amenities at Lochgelly Train Station

Lochgelly Train Station offers basic amenities to ensure a comfortable journey. While there is no ticket office or machines available for collecting tickets, travelers can purchase tickets online and use them accordingly, as smartcard validators are available. Accessibility options at the station include partial step-free access, categorizing it as a Category B station. Facilities like induction loops are available for hearing-impaired passengers, and there are a couple of blue badge parking bays for those with mobility issues. However, do note that amenities such as toilets, shops, refreshment facilities, and Wi-Fi are not present, so plan ahead for such necessities.

Onward Travel Options

Should you need to travel beyond Lochgelly, there are several transportation links to aid your onward journey. Buses are a primary mode of supplementary transport, with a rail replacement service that picks up or drops off at the foot of the station's car park. Check the bus timings at Traveline Scotland for detailed information. While taxi services aren't explicitly stationed at Lochgelly, you can consult TrainTaxi for options in the area. Although car parking is available, car rentals are not facilitated directly at the station.
